Overall Meaning

The opening lines of Orange Goblin's "Cozmo Bozo" are a paradoxical invitation that asks whether theirs is a shared journey or rather an abyss of mutual incomprehension. If they do share their lives, then why is it that one of them always seems to be missing? The second line stands out because it implies that one person's way of looking at things may be different from the other's, making it hard to connect with them. Lines 3 and 4 seem to describe a power relationship characterized by a king ruling over his subjects who pay homage to him on their knees, possibly through sexual submission.


The chorus leaps from frustration to resignation, describing the pain of a one-sided relationship. Love is offered, but sorrow is all that is given in return. The singer feels defeated, living in a house where the lights are always on, but no one feels like "home." What good are possessions and earthly pleasures when you are miserable and alone? The last verse features a list of desires, which seems to encapsulate the singer's yearnings, but in the end, it all comes down to needing love and maybe some alcoholic beverages.
